Exploring Dutch Cuisine in the USA
Dutch cuisine is a delightful blend of traditional flavors and modern innovation. Originating from the Netherlands, Dutch cuisine has gained popularity in the United States due to its unique taste and variety. Dutch restaurants in the USA offer a range of traditional dishes that are a must-try for food enthusiasts.
One of the most iconic Dutch dishes is the bitterballen, which are deep-fried balls of meat ragout served with mustard sauce. Another traditional Dutch dish is stamppot, a mashed potatoes dish mixed with vegetables such as kale or sauerkraut, and served with sausage or bacon.
Other popular Dutch dishes that have become favorites among Americans include the Dutch apple pie, poffertjes (small, fluffy pancakes dusted with powdered sugar), and stroopwafels (thin waffles with a caramel filling).
